GABA
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id, a chief inhibitory neurotransmitter in the central nervous system, playing a key role in reducing neuronal excitability.
Anandamides
Naturally occurring compounds in the body that bind to cannabinoid receptors, influencing mood, appetite, and pain perception.
Dopamine
A chemical messenger that plays a critical role in controlling mood, motivation, pleasure, and reward sensations.
Synergistic Effect
The interaction of two or more agents or forces so that their combined effect is greater than the sum of their individual effects.
